Carbon dioxide buildup in bedrooms is a silent sleep killer that most people never consider. The GoveeLife CO2 Detector specifically addresses this problem, and after using it for a month, I noticed a direct correlation between high CO2 readings and my morning grogginess.

The SCD4x photoacoustic NDIR sensor provides accurate readings with built-in pressure compensation, which matters because altitude and weather changes affect CO2 measurements. I tested it by closing my bedroom door overnight and watched levels climb from 450ppm to over 1200ppm by morning, explaining my frequent headaches.

The triple alert system impressed me during testing. When CO2 exceeded my set threshold, I received app notifications, email alerts, and audible beeps from the device. The customizable LED brightness let me dim it completely at night while still getting daytime visibility.

Integration with Alexa and Google Assistant means I can ask for CO2 levels verbally, and the 2-year data export helped me share readings with my doctor when discussing sleep issues. The 4.82-inch display shows CO2, temperature, humidity, and time simultaneously.

How to Choose the Best Smart Air Quality Monitor for Your Bedroom

Selecting the right air quality monitor for your bedroom requires understanding which pollutants matter most for sleep quality and how different features impact bedroom-specific use cases.

Key Pollutants to Monitor

PM2.5 refers to fine particulate matter smaller than 2.5 micrometers that penetrates deep into lungs and can cause respiratory irritation. Sources include outdoor pollution, dust, pet dander, and cooking particles. For bedrooms, aim for PM2.5 levels below 12 micrograms per cubic meter for optimal air quality.

CO2 or carbon dioxide builds up overnight in closed bedrooms as you exhale. Levels above 1000ppm can cause drowsiness, headaches, and reduced cognitive function. For sleep quality, keep bedroom CO2 below 800ppm by ensuring adequate ventilation or running an air exchange system.

VOCs or volatile organic compounds come from furniture, paint, cleaning products, and personal care items. Long-term exposure affects respiratory health and sleep quality. Monitors with VOC detection help identify and eliminate hidden pollution sources in bedrooms.

Bedroom-Specific Features

Display brightness matters significantly for bedroom use. Monitors with adjustable brightness or night mode prevent sleep disruption from glowing screens. The best options allow complete display dimming while still providing app-based alerts if needed.

Noise level from internal fans or alert sounds can disturb light sleepers. Look for monitors with quiet operation or silent mode options. The SONOFF and GoveeLife models offer quieter operation compared to monitors with audible sampling fans.

Placement flexibility affects monitoring accuracy. Position monitors at breathing height, away from direct airflow from vents or windows, and not directly beside your bed where breathing affects readings. Allow 3-5 feet from your pillow for representative bedroom air quality data.

Accuracy and Calibration

Consumer-grade monitors vary significantly in accuracy. NDIR sensors for CO2 generally outperform photoacoustic alternatives for precision. PM2.5 laser sensors from reputable manufacturers like Sensirion or Plantower provide reliable particulate measurements when properly calibrated.

Allow new monitors 24-48 hours to stabilize before trusting readings. Many devices include auto-calibration features that reference fresh outdoor air at approximately 400ppm CO2. For critical applications, consider professional calibration or cross-reference with multiple devices.

Frequently Asked Questions

How reliable are air quality monitors?

Consumer air quality monitors provide reliable trend data but vary in absolute accuracy compared to professional equipment. Quality monitors from reputable brands using NDIR sensors for CO2 and laser particle counters for PM2.5 typically achieve accuracy within 10-15% of reference devices. For bedroom use, relative changes and trends matter more than laboratory-grade precision.

Do air quality monitors really work?

Yes, quality air quality monitors effectively detect changes in indoor air pollutants. During testing, our monitors consistently detected PM2.5 spikes from cooking, CO2 buildup from closed bedrooms overnight, and VOC releases from cleaning products. While consumer devices cannot match professional laboratory equipment, they provide actionable data for improving indoor air quality.

Can an air quality monitor detect mold?

Air quality monitors cannot directly detect mold, but some can indicate conditions that promote mold growth. High humidity readings above 60% and elevated VOC levels may suggest mold presence. For confirmed mold detection, you need specialized equipment or professional inspection. Monitors help identify humidity problems before mold develops.

How long do air quality monitors last?

Most air quality monitors last 3-5 years with proper care. NDIR CO2 sensors typically maintain accuracy longer than electrochemical VOC sensors, which may drift after 2-3 years. Some monitors like the Aranet4 offer replaceable sensors, extending device lifespan. Battery-powered units may need battery replacement after 2-3 years of daily use.

Where should I place an air quality monitor in my bedroom?

Place your bedroom air quality monitor at breathing height, approximately 3-5 feet from your pillow, away from direct airflow from vents, windows, or fans. Avoid placing monitors on the floor where dust concentration is higher, or directly beside your bed where your breath affects readings. For comprehensive monitoring, position the device where it samples representative bedroom air.
